Embracing a Prophetic Year of Grace, Renewal, and New Beginnings

The convergence of the Hebrew year 5785 and the Gregorian year 2025 presents a profound opportunity to discern prophetic meaning and align with God’s plans for a year of change and renewal. To explore its significance, let’s break it down through biblical numerology, Hebrew insights, and spiritual themes.


1. The Year 5785 in the Hebrew Calendar

  • Numerical Breakdown:
    In Hebrew, numbers also correspond to letters and concepts. Breaking down 5785:
    • 5 (Hei): Represents grace, divine revelation, and God’s presence.
    • 7 (Zayin): Symbolizes completion, rest, and spiritual perfection. It is often associated with warfare and tools, reminding us of spiritual battles and victory through God’s strength.
    • 8 (Chet): Represents new beginnings, renewal, and supernatural abundance.
    • 5 (Hei, repeated): Reinforces the theme of God’s grace and divine intervention.

Together, 5785 can prophetically suggest a season of grace, spiritual renewal, and supernatural new beginnings. It is a year where God’s people are called to rest in His grace while stepping into a fresh chapter of spiritual growth and victory.

  • The Decade of 5780s – The Mouth (Peh):
    The Hebrew letter associated with the 80s decade is Peh (פ), symbolizing the mouth. This is a decade of speaking, declaring, and proclaiming God’s truth. In 5785, the grace and renewal of God align with the need to speak life, truth, and blessing over ourselves, our communities, and the world.

2. The Year 2025 in the Gregorian Calendar

  • Numerical Breakdown:
    • 20: Symbolizes redemption, deliverance, and divine completion of trials.
    • 25: Represents grace multiplied (5 x 5), pointing to abundant blessings and favor.

Together, 2025 highlights a time of divine intervention and multiplied grace, aligning beautifully with the themes of 5785. It is a year to experience the fruit of past perseverance while stepping boldly into new assignments.


3. Combined Prophetic Themes: 5785 + 2025

The convergence of these two years suggests a pivotal season of change, spiritual renewal, and divine commissioning. Here are some key prophetic insights:

A Year of New Beginnings:

  • The overlap of 8 (new beginnings) from 5785 and the multiplied 5s (grace) in 2025 highlights this as a time of supernatural transition. God is opening new doors, ending old cycles, and inviting His people into fresh assignments.

A Call to Proclaim and Declare:

  • The 5780s (Peh) remind us of the power of the mouth. In 5785, believers are called to speak boldly, declare God’s promises, and align their words with His truth. This is a season to create with your words and speak life into challenging situations.

A Time of Spiritual Battle and Victory:

  • The 7 (completion and warfare) in 5785 points to spiritual battles that lead to breakthroughs. God’s people are being equipped to stand firm, wield the tools of spiritual warfare, and step into victory.

Multiplied Grace and Abundance:

  • The repeated 5s (grace) in both years underscore a season of favor and divine empowerment. This grace is not passive but active, enabling believers to walk boldly in their God-given purposes.

4. Biblical Parallels for 5785 and 2025

  • Ezra’s Rebuilding (Ezra 7:9-10):
    In the Hebrew calendar, the number 7 is associated with restoration, while 8 signifies renewal. These themes mirror Ezra’s journey to rebuild the temple, a time of restoring worship and aligning God’s people with His covenant.
  • Isaiah 43:19:
    “See, I am doing a new thing! Now it springs up; do you not perceive it?”
    This verse captures the heart of 5785/2025—a year of new beginnings, spiritual breakthroughs, and the manifestation of God’s plans.
  • The Year of Jubilee:
    The themes of grace and renewal echo the biblical concept of Jubilee, where debts are canceled, captives are freed, and the land experiences rest. While not technically a Jubilee year, 5785/2025 carries similar spiritual undertones of release and restoration.

5. Prophetic Significance of Change

This year is a prophetic invitation to:

  1. Step Into New Assignments: God is opening doors for fresh opportunities. Be ready to say “yes” to His call.
  2. Speak Life: Use your words to align with God’s purposes, proclaim His promises, and declare victory over adversity.
  3. Rest in Grace: Trust in God’s unmerited favor to empower, sustain, and guide you through transitions.
  4. Engage in Spiritual Renewal: Deepen your relationship with Yeshua, align your heart with His Word, and embrace His transformative work in your life.
  5. Prepare for Harvest: This is a season to sow spiritually, anticipating a harvest of souls and blessings in due time.

Conclusion: A Kingdom Perspective for 5785/2025

The alignment of the Hebrew and Gregorian years reminds us of God’s sovereignty and His call to live with eternal perspective. This is not merely a year of external change but a time to embrace internal transformation, walk boldly in faith, and partner with God in His Kingdom purposes.

Let us enter this season with hearts set on things above (Colossians 3:2), ready to speak His truth, embrace His grace, and fulfill His plans. The best is yet to come!
